Transaction fab82e22d39ce773982501a0e5bd1c11625a4ca67ed352d9e3188ce103fa70e9
1 Input
1 Output
-
fab82e22d39ce773982501a0e5bd1c11625a4ca67ed352d9e3188ce103fa70e9:0
- value
- 175614
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ec6d2118caab6840418adb69642c94b873cff9f0 OP_EQUAL
- address
- 3PF88FXoQUErWyn8cjWbLaE8thX7JD415f